How Dangerous Is Pancreatitis From MEPOLIZUMAB?

Of the 110 reports, 20 (18.2%) resulted in death, 49 (44.5%) required hospitalization, and 17 (15.5%) were considered life-threatening.

Is Pancreatitis Listed in the Official Label?

This adverse event is not currently listed in the official FDA drug label for MEPOLIZUMAB. However, 110 reports have been filed with the FAERS database.
